Ag₁Te₂Tl₁ is an intermetallic compound combining silver, tellurium, and thallium elements, belonging to the chalcogenide family of materials. This is primarily a research-phase material studied for potential thermoelectric and semiconductor applications, where the combination of heavy elements (Tl, Te) with silver offers tunable electronic and thermal transport properties. The material's use remains largely experimental, with development focused on energy conversion and solid-state device applications where unconventional band structures and phonon scattering mechanisms can be exploited.
